The Book Without Words

The Book Without Words by Avi is a captivating tale published by Hyperion Book CH on July 1, 2005. This edition spans 208 pages and is presented in English. The narrative centers around a seemingly blank book that holds the secrets of magical arts, including the ability to create gold and attain immortality. When a desperate boy comes into possession of this mysterious volume, the story unfolds with themes of desire and the consequences of wielding such power.
Readers will discover a rich exploration of the magical arts as the boy navigates the challenges that arise from his newfound knowledge. The book delves into the themes of ambition and the age-old struggle between those who seek to protect magic and those who wish to exploit it. With its intriguing premise, The Book Without Words invites readers into a world where the allure of power and the weight of responsibility intertwine, making it a thought-provoking addition to the juvenile fiction genre.
Official synopsis Publisher
The Book Without Words appears to be a volume of blank parchment pages. But for a green-eyed reader filled with great desire, it may reveal the forgotten magical arts of making gold and achieving immortality. For generations, its magic has been protected from those who would exploit it. But on a terrible day of death and destruction, the Book Without Words falls into the hands of a desperate boy.
